April LIM Topic(s): We will be reviewing all 7 habits this month:
- Habit 1: Habit 1: Be Proactive® You're in Charge. ...
- Habit 2: Begin With the End in Mind® Have a Plan. ...
- Habit 3: Put First Things First® Work First, Then Play. ...
- Habit 4: Think Win-Win® ...
- Habit 5: Seek First to Understand, Then to Be Understood® ...
- Habit 6: Synergize® ...
- Habit 7: Sharpen the Saw®
